Objectives: Bicuspid aortic valve (BAV) is the most common congenital cardiac abnormality and often leads to severe aortic stenosis (AS) at a younger age compared to tricuspid valves. Inflammation plays a key role in the pathogenesis of AS. This study aimed to investigate the association between the Systemic Immune-Inflammation Index (SII) and disease severity in patients with severe BAV-AS.Methods: In this retrospective observational study, 76 patients with severe BAV-AS and 76 age- and sex-matched controls without AS were included.

Routine laboratory data and transthoracic echocardiographic parameters were recorded. SII was calculated as platelet count × neutrophil count / lymphocyte count. The severity of AS was determined by aortic valve area (AVA) and mean transvalvular gradient.
